The Overall Health Score in 49659, Mancelona, Michigan is 17 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
86.91 percent of the population in 49659 drive to work alone. 0.85 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 60.30 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 8.81 percent of the residents in 49659 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 1.57 members with about 2.26 cars available per household.
An estimate of 92.80 percent of the residents in 49659 has some form of health insurance. 49.34 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 62.12 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 49659 would have to travel an average of 12.51 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Kalkaska Memorial Health Center . In a 20-mile radius, there are 278 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 49659, Mancelona, Michigan.

As of , an estimate of 7,167 residents live in 49659 with a median age of 44.0 years. 21.46 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 19.44 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 39.85 percent of the residents in 49659 is currently married, and 20.65 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 49659 is $4,777.17.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 49659 is approximately $745. The median household spends about 15.60 percent of their income on housing.

Healthcare Facilities and Services
Mancelona is home to several healthcare facilities that cater to the medical needs of its residents. The Munson Healthcare Mancelona Family Health Center is a primary care facility that provides a wide range of services, including preventive care, chronic disease management, and routine check-ups. This center offers accessible healthcare services for individuals of all ages, ensuring that residents have access to essential medical care close to home.
For more specialized care, residents can easily access larger healthcare facilities in nearby towns such as Traverse City or Petoskey. Munson Healthcare Grayling Hospital is approximately 30 minutes away from Mancelona and offers comprehensive medical services, including emergency care, surgical procedures, and specialty clinics. This close proximity to larger medical centers ensures that residents have access to advanced healthcare options when needed.
